Output e8a8438396980e6eabe26b1364225ed67dcaa098e01210a21d5c8628574a9b87:1

value
996062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b682ff8cdceb62aac4c78817a02802200ddb4f OP_EQUAL
address
MTUTUco46JYC7yZpe2fRbdmBvWwvtfJVFf
transaction
e8a8438396980e6eabe26b1364225ed67dcaa098e01210a21d5c8628574a9b87
spent
true